jsp连接MYSQL数据库教程(文字+图)

编程知识 更新时间:2023-04-08 03:03:42

步骤:

1.在mysql官网下载JDBC驱动程序。网址:https://dev.mysql/downloads/connector/j/

2.把里面的jar包(mysql-connector-java-5.1.41-bin.jar)放进tomcat的安装目录的lib文件夹下,如我的目录是:C:\apache-tomcat-8.0.36-windows-x64\apache-tomcat-8.0.36\lib。重启tomcat。

3.在mysql中创建试验数据,首先创建数据库,名为testdb;然后建立表格,名为testform,表有三个字段,分别为:id,name,age;最后添加几行试验数据。如图:

4.eclipse里面创建工程,并创建一个JSP文件,命名为test.jsp。test.jsp代码如下:(注意修改相应参数)

    <%@ page contentType="text/html; charset=utf-8" language="java" import="java.sql.*" errorPage="" %>  
    <%  
    //驱动程序名  
    String driverName = "com.mysql.jdbc.Driver";  
    //数据库用户名  
    String userName = "root";  
    //密码  
    String userPasswd = "123456";  
    //数据库名  
    String dbName = "testdb";  
    //表名  
    String tableName = "testform";  
    //联结字符串  
    String url = "jdbc:mysql://localhost/" + dbName + "?user=" + userName + "&password=" + userPasswd;  
    //加载驱动  
    Class.forName("com.mysql.jdbc.Driver").newInstance();  
    //建立连接  
    Connection conn = DriverManager.getConnection(url);     
    //创建Statement(负责执行sql语句)  
    Statement stmt = conn.createStatement();  
    String sql="select * from " + tableName;  
    //获得数据结果集合  
    ResultSet rs = stmt.executeQuery(sql);  
    //依次遍历结果集(表中的记录)  
    while(rs.next())  
    {  
        //依据数据库中的字段名打印数据  
        out.println(rs.getString("name"));  
        out.println(rs.getString("age"));  
    }  
    //关闭连接  
    rs.close();  
    stmt.close();  
    conn.close();  
    %>  
5.运行jsp文件。若出现如下图所示,则连接成功。如图:


更多推荐

jsp连接MYSQL数据库教程(文字+图)

本文发布于:2023-04-08 03:03:00,感谢您对本站的认可!
本文链接:https://www.elefans.com/category/jswz/987b0f8ccbba3f96ccb56d631e738c5a.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
本文标签:文字   数据库   教程   jsp   MYSQL

发布评论

评论列表 (有 0 条评论)
草根站长

>www.elefans.com

编程频道|电子爱好者 - 技术资讯及电子产品介绍!

  • 55585文章数
  • 14阅读数
  • 0评论数